3 Cross Heath Cottages is a semi-detached house in Coleshill, Birmingham, Birmingham (B46 2AG). It has a recorded floor area of 75 m² (around 807 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(June 2017) shows an E (score 48),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. When first surveyed in September 2010 the rating was G,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 78),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il.
